- Git bash docker command not found ubuntu example. Anaconda and Git Bash in Windows - conda: command not found. Conclusion. I can't tell for sure if this command is being run on Ubuntu or php5. Unable to use sudo commands within Docker, "bash Dec 6, 2023 · Docker Run Bash: How to Run a Bash Shell in a Container Error "'git' is not recognized as an internal or external . However, you can of course not call the "docker" command inside of d1. Apr 12, 2019 · I can use it: $ docker run -it dock. In summary, the "docker build" command is a powerful tool that automates the process of creating Docker images from Dockerfiles. Jan 25, 2024 · Resolve the "bash: docker: command not found" issue in Linux with these steps: Install Docker, update your shell profile, and ensure proper permissions. Get back to seamless Docker usage! Apr 10, 2022 · I am trying to run docker commands from inside my container, but I always get the response "bash: docker: command not found". In this tutorial, we will guide you through the process of installing and using the Sep 24, 2017 · python - Pipenv: Command Not Found Aug 31, 2017 · Are you able to access the files now? I tried using this same method but not able to see the windows files. I use Linux on my home machines, but Windows at work. Pls, can you show us the entire Dockerfile and how you run the container; or with which command/entrypoint start the container. It stands for ‘superuser do,’ allowing a permitted user to execute a command as the superuser or another user, as specified in the sudoers file. yml file? TTY Error running interactive docker on Bash on Windows Jan 10, 2021 · The problem is executables on windows wants to see path(s) as "windows" (e. apt-get install -y git. sh) which is supposed to run a Docker image that I’ve already built. If you get the bash: netstat: command not found error, it means the Linux distro you’re using does not have netstat installed. I Use bind mounts Troubleshoot topics for Docker Desktop Mar 16, 2021 · I am not able to use kubectl command inside gitlab-ci. By following these steps, you can install Git on a Generic Linux system and start using this powerful version control system for your projects. git init. netstat is the part of another tool called net-tools. 04 Using the RUN instruction in a Dockerfile with 'source' does Feb 5, 2020 · I recently upgraded Docker Desktop for Mac to version 2. c:\whatever\is\here) but instead what they get the "posix" equivalent ( e. I have already gone through the steps mentioned in the doc to add an existing cluster in the doc. I use git-bash on Windows, instead of Powershell or CMD, so that I’m not constantly switching command line environments. Git is a popular version control system that allows you to track changes in your codebase. So use your distro’s package manager to install net-tools. Nov 3, 2020 · Background in my gitlab-ci file I am trying to build a docker image, however even though I have docker:dind as a service, it is failing. Jun 6, 2019 · $ apk add --update -y python-pip bash: line 82: apk: command not found ERROR: Job failed: exit status 1 How am I supposed to install apk? Or what image other than docker should I be using to run this gitlab-ci. My bash shell knows where git is: which git /usr/local/bin/git. root@6a6bec871690:/# ls usr/src/app/. Jan 5, 2022 · [Fixed] How to Fix "bash: sudo: command not found" Error May 21, 2012 · let me explain with an example docker won't work directly on the git bash terminal, for such apps MSYS is converting it origin path. But /bin/sh can’t find git. Jan 6, 2020 · Running a script inside a docker container using shell script Dec 24, 2019 · Docker Exec Command With Examples Can't run Curl command inside my Docker Container Apr 15, 2017 · Take image ubuntu as an example, if you run docker inspect ubuntu, you'll find the following configs in the output: "Cmd": ["/bin/bash"] which means the process got started when you run docker run ubuntu is /bin/bash, but you're not in an interactive mode and does not allocate a tty to it, so the process exited immediately and the container Apr 12, 2021 · git clone:command not found Use Docker to build Docker images May 2, 2024 · [Solved] "bash: docker: command not found" Error - LinuxSimply Jun 13, 2018 · Some thoughts: Replace apt-get install git with apt-get install --assume-yes git. Jun 30, 2017 · Docker not found when building docker image using Nov 26, 2023 · Understanding the Sudo Command and Its Role. This typically occurs when Docker is not installed properly or when its executable is not included in the system’s PATH environment variable. That will avoid the git bash session to automatically resolve /bin/bash to C:/Program Files/Git/usr/bin/bash, which won't be known at all by the ubuntu container. This document saying:. You switched accounts on another tab or window. For certain executors, the runner passes the --login flag as shown above, which also loads the shell profile. So npm is installed in the image but I cannot run it without entering the container first. Jul 6, 2018 · I am trying to build my docker image within the gitlab ci pipeline. Any suggestions? Run your CI/CD jobs in Docker containers Sep 13, 2012 · How to configure git bash command line completion? Mar 18, 2024 · Use Bash With Alpine Based Docker Image Apr 21, 2022 · bash: netstat: command not found. bashrc it is more common to use a non-login shell. You can change it in the lower RHS in intelliJ. When I execute sudo apt-get install -y docker-ce the system tells me that docker is already installed: $ sudo apt-get install -y docker-ce Oct 30, 2023 · With an understanding of what causes the docker command not found error, let‘s go through the steps to properly install Docker and configure your PATH to fix this issue for good when using Zsh on MacOS. Jan 20, 2024 · To resolve this, open Docker Desktop, go to Settings, and navigate to Resources -> WSL Integration. First, you need to install Git on your system, then you need to verify Hi there! I would like to experiment in GitHub Codespaces with Docker / docker-compose but I found that the commands are not found: bash: docker: command not found bash: docker-compose: command not Run Docker commands in Bitbucket Pipelines The ifconfig command, short for “interface configuration,” is a powerful tool used in Linux systems, including Ubuntu, to display and configure network interfaces. Disregard. . just run . To install Git on Ubuntu, follow these steps: Apr 28, 2024 · I’m encountering issues while trying to run a script (run. The docker command works in the Command Prompt and in Powershell, but not in Git Bash. Run sudo command with non-root user in Docker container Jan 1, 2022 · I feel like I have tried everything, and don't understand why commands can't be found in my GitLab CI script. Jul 22, 2020 · Hi @maisammd,. 9. 2. 2024-03-14. I had to run the following from terminal after doing the above: docker run -d -p 80:80 docker/getting-started Dec 31, 2023 · docker compus up -d. Once Mar 15, 2021 · I’m getting the error “/bin/sh: git: not found” when running ‘docker build’. By defining instructions in the Dockerfile, users can specify the desired configuration of the image and leverage Docker's layered approach and caching mechanisms to efficiently build and share containerized applications. 14. ssh/known Postgresql -bash: psql: command not found Aug 17, 2018 · I had $'\r': command not found because after pushing and pulling to Git the line separator changed to Windows CRLF. But is the docker-php-ext-install command supposed to be executed from the Ubuntu shell? Jul 1, 2024 · How To Install Git on Ubuntu May 11, 2015 · How do I get into a Docker container's shell? Sep 5, 2013 · To fix this broken symlink on Windows, run the following in a Command Prompt as an administrator (not in PowerShell nor Git Bash): # Delete this Windows symlink directory if it exists and you need to recreate # and fix it. json Stack/ UninstalItems. stages: - build build: image: ubuntu:20. Step 1: Update Package Index; docker exec command not found - Amazon Linux. org Jan 15, 2020 · After the debian will install and run when you try to run the > git command it will say “git command not found”. 6 . Do not know why, I am not able to find the man command on bash. This means root@d1:/# docker will not and should not work. In the installation process I installed Docker (as a snap). Mar 13, 2013 · BASH has a whole slew of ways of automatically setting your prompt to give you nice information. 0. txt ls /c/temp 'Encoding Time. How can I tell /bin/sh where git is located? Edited to add: Using macOS 10. TTY Often, I use Docker containers to run an interactive Linux environment to use tools that are either not available on sudo: docker-compose: command not found Jan 17, 2021 · (With my information-security hat on, I also really, really hate to see containers following this pattern -- when the software gets upgraded at build time to whatever-a-network-resource-happens-to-currently-have you have no guarantees about exactly which packages are active in any given run, and also need to be sure you rebuild your containers after relevant security updates; the Nix approach Sep 29, 2020 · Gitlab-CI with Docker executor /usr/bin/bash: line 90: git: command not found 0 The GitLab pipeline is not executing the command in the script section for a docker image Mar 14, 2024 · If Git is successfully installed, you will see the installed version number. txt Projects/ selfcheck. for debian /ubuntu . It seems like this is being run on Ubuntu given the apt-get update commands. yml -p my-project build Nov 3, 2020 · image is used to specify the image in which to run the script. This means that the Docker CLI is not available to your shell when you try to run a Docker command. sh and it seems to work fine when running it on ubuntu but when I run it on Windows using Git Bash I Sep 12, 2023 · Bash: docker: command not found Dec 23, 2016 · You signed in with another tab or window. I’m trying to do this in GitBash on Windows 10. /bin/bash: line 69: docker: command not found ERROR: Job failed: error Feb 5, 2018 · docker error on windows : the input device is not a TTY. The OP confirms this is working, provided the following options are added: Oct 14, 2022 · I am also at docker toolbox windows, and as in this question doesn't not seem to be replies regarding the question docker toolbox on windows, but running into embedded VM docker-machine ssh, there is a command IP, but there are not package managers yum and apt, as I seem to miss other packages-not the IP, so I guess, I will have to use Ubuntu windows subsystem, which is as far as I know not According to this document:. 04 stage: build only: - master tags: - docker script: - adduser --disabled-password --gecos "" meteor_install - apt update -y - apt install curl -y - su meteor_install - echo $0 - cd ~ - ls -alh - curl -o- https://raw Dockerfile reference May 2, 2024 · The above command establishes a symbolic link between the Angular CLI package and the npm global directory, allowing you to use the ng command globally from any terminal session. See full list on geeksforgeeks. Jan 20, 2022 · I'm running the following in a Docker container (in a Gitlab CI/CD pipeline) with the python:3 image. You set the prompt by setting the PS1 environment variable. d1 /bin/bash you are connected to container d1 and the following commands are executed inside container d1. 0. Apr 4, 2022 · How To Install and Set Up Laravel with Docker Compose Sep 19, 2015 · @KevinArrrrrg yes, for just accessing a running container from the docker engine host, a docker exec <container> bash is enough. Aug 22, 2019 · I am trying to install docker on an Ubuntu-16. There, you’ll likely see a message prompting you to convert to WSL version 2. A better approach is to provide a fully qualified and meaningful repository, name, and tag (where the tag in this context means the qualifier after the ":"). Containers are a way to package up an application and its dependencies so that it can be run on any machine, regardless of its operating system or hardware configuration. yml file. csv' http1/ netstat. Other commands like $ ssh user@host date or $ ssh user@host 'ls -l' woks fine. g. Based on the output, this wasn't even necessary because git was already installed. Jul 23, 2017 · docker run ubuntu /bin/bash vs docker run ubuntu Jun 26, 2018 · # this is our first build stage, it will not persist in the final image FROM ubuntu as intermediate # install git RUN apt-get update RUN apt-get install -y git # add credentials on build ARG SSH_PRIVATE_KEY RUN mkdir /root/. Jun 1, 2022 · The fixed that issue, but now I'm having a problem with the config use-context part, it said "no context exists with the name" When I set that part up I had a feeling I didn't put the correct path. However it is not able to find the docker command. Dockerfile Gemfile Gemfile. If you are using Kali Linux Bash and encountering the “git command not found” error, then you can easily fix it by following the steps outlined in this article. Without the --assume-yes it will prompt you for confirmation, which you are unable to give and it will be smart enough to figure that out and assume you meant "NO". Here is my script. Install Terraform Here are some examples: Though it is not a good practice, image names can be arbitrary: docker build -t myimage . Mar 19, 2024 · When you see the error message “Bash: Docker: Command Not Found,” it means that the Bash shell cannot find the Docker executable in its path. Jul 30, 2023 · If that doesn’t work, then you can try running the command as the root user: sudo -i. Despite Docker being installed and accessible from the command line, the script fails with errors such as “docker: command not found”. 10 running as a virtual machine. For example, if I set PS1="$ "my prompt will look like this: Oct 24, 2022 · How To Install Git on Ubuntu 22. You signed out in another tab or window. 2 The `docker: command not found` error occurs when you try to run a Docker command but the Docker CLI is not installed or is not in your path. Apr 21, 2020 · /bin/bash: npm: command not found If I instead do: docker run -it my-npm-image /bin/bash root@laptop:/# npm --version 6. I am on a windows 7 box running Docker via docker-machine. lock README. Page content. c:/whatever/is/here). md docker_files go root@6a6bec871690:/#. May 21, 2015 · docker command not found even though installed with apt-get I’ve run across a few problems when running Docker CLI commands from git-bash on Windows. docker run -v //c/temp/:/test alpine ls test temp. The sudo command is a crucial tool in a Linux system. ssh/id_rsa # make sure your domain is accepted RUN touch /root/. Notice running other commands works fine using the above approach: docker run my-npm-image /bin/bash -c "git --version Running containers | Docker Docs Nov 16, 2017 · So I am running a script that calls: docker-compose run --rm web sh /data/bin/install_test_db. 10. ssh/ RUN echo "${SSH_PRIVATE_KEY}" > /root/. Also /usr/local/bin is the first item in my $PATH. That is how it should be. Docker is a popular tool for creating and managing containers. log It appears the docker container has it's own separate and independent copy of the c:\temp directory Mar 14, 2024 · How to Install git Command on Ubuntu. – Apr 5, 2018 · When installing Rust toolchain in Docker, Bash `source` Mar 17, 2024 · The docker exec command is a powerful utility that allows users to execute commands inside a running Docker container. When I run the docker Windows doesn't recognize Docker command Mar 14, 2024 · Docker command not found - Ubuntu. I can confirm that when I enter “docker --version”, I get: “Docker Summary. gitlab-ci --- stages: - build - docker build: stage: build image: fl4m3p… Docker: Command Not Found. Everything is fine when I log in using SSH, but this will fail: $ ssh user@host 'docker info' returning: bash: docker: command not found. 0 It works. . for such issues you might need to tell your terminal ignore path conversion using command MSYS_NO_PATHCONV=1 and proceed with your actual execution command, say for example docker --help should be like below Sep 22, 2018 · When you do xterm d1 or sudo docker exec -it mn. This command comes in handy when you need to troubleshoot or perform specific tasks within a container without having to start a new one. 6 (Mojave), Docker version 20. The image keyword is the name of the Docker image the Docker executor runs to perform the CI tasks. If you are using Ubuntu and trying to use the git command but getting a “command not found” error, it means that Git is not installed on your system. You have to rebuild your docker compose. Jun 3, 2022 · Ubuntu Error "The command 'docker' could not be found in Dec 3, 2019 · i'm running 2 gitlab-runner executors: shell executor (tagged: shell_executor) docker executor (tagged: docker_executor) the docker executor runs docker commands just fine, but the shell executor Mar 5, 2020 · I'm accessing Ubuntu 19. Oct 10, 2015 · Am getting started with Docker and just pulled up a basic ubuntu image. bash: line 106: docker-php-ext-install: command not found. But for accessing a running container from another machine, ssh is a legitimate listener, whic has to be installed though. 0, and now when try to run a docker-machine command I am getting an error: $ docker-machine --version docker-machine: command not fou Build context | Docker Docs Build context Sep 4, 2017 · If possible, try the same command in a regular DOS session, instead of a git bash. 04 server. net-tools is available in almost all Linux distributions repositories. This won't work. As far as I can see, you are setting up all to en environment for the shell bash; but if you never execute bash, this enviroment will never exist. You want to run the script in a docker image, to build your image. Ubuntu. and as you see my files were copied and aliases created for root. If Jul 4, 2021 · I have Docker Desktop for Windows and Git (including Git Bash) installed on my computer. Oct 6, 2016 · Docker - Ubuntu - bash: ping: command not found docker container commit Sep 22, 2020 · After installing docker using Homebrew, start the Docker daemon by searching for Docker in the Application folder in Finder and running it. I've built my image successfully, and run it by trying the following two ways: docker run -it ubuntu bash and docker run -it ubuntu. Issue resolved! The problem was my WSL Ubuntu distro installed without DNS configuration so name resolution wasn’t working, that plus I had to install my companies web proxy certificate to get github and other basic supporting packages working before moving on the docker commands. Reload to refresh your session. Run the below command. Apr 20, 2016 · "free command not found" while running bash script using git bash. I installed git using the following command: apt-get update. rmdir some_dir # Delete the Linux symlink file which was cloned to Windows as a plain text # file. Nowhere they have mentioned, How ca Apr 5, 2020 · Add shell or bash to a docker image (Distroless based on Aug 24, 2022 · $ docker-php-ext-install soap. > apt-get update && apt-get install -y git. CommandFound. docker compose -f docker/docker-compose. With ifconfig , you can view information about your network interfaces, assign IP addresses, enable or disable interfaces, and more. bash: git: command not found. plf vow aljnoq rpjejdf tjmvnzlq dho tmxth myhvu mjcvad ejsvok